Planning 2025 Home Sale Budget: Essential Fees & Hidden Costs Revealed

Selling your property in 2025 is a big decision, and it's crucial to understand the costs involved. While the initial price may seem like the biggest expense, there are plenty of hidden fees that Real estate agent Miami can accumulate your total expenses.

Here's a breakdown of essential fees to include in your budget:

* **Real Estate Agent Commissions:** Typically ranging from 4% to 6%, these commissions involve the agent's help.

* **Closing Costs:** These expenses can vary widely depending on your location and transaction. Expect to spend for title insurance, escrow fees, appraisal costs, and recording fees.

* **Staging Costs:** To make your home more attractive, staging services can be helpful.

* **Repairs & Renovations:** Minor repairs and updates can help increase your selling price.

Don't ignore these possible costs:

* **Prepaid Property Taxes:** You may need to pay any outstanding property taxes at closing.

* **HOA Fees:** If you live in a neighborhood with an HOA, you'll likely need to pay any outstanding fees.

By thoroughly planning your budget and recognizing all the costs, you can make sure a smooth and successful home sale in 2025.

Selling a House in 2025: The True Cost

Predicting the exact cost to sell a house in 2025 is like predicting the weather months in advance - there are just too many elements at play. Market fluctuations, loan costs, and even local real estate trends can all have a significant effect. That said, we can provide insight on the typical expenses you can expect to incur when selling your home.

First, there are the standard closing costs, which typically range from 5% to 7% of the final sale price. This includes fees for things like appraisals, title insurance, and escrow services. Then there's the question of real estate agent commissions, which can vary depending on your location and the agent's experience. Generally, expect to pay between 5% and 6% of the sale price in commission fees.

Of course, these are just the fundamental costs. You might also need to factor in additional expenses like home repairs, staging costs, or even professional photography.

It's crucial to consider that every house sale is unique, so it's best to consult with a local real estate professional for a more precise estimate of the costs involved.
